At Fri, 5 Oct 2001, Stacey wrote: >
>For the last two days I have had a burning/stinging feeling in my
>vagina. There has also been a slight white discharge, which is normal
>for me. I figured it was a yeast infection so I picked up some
>Monistat. After using it, the burning/itching increased 10-fold and had
>me doubled over in discomfort. I'm now assuming that maybe it's not a
>yeast infection and that I should stop using the monistat. Is that
>correct? I haven't had a yeast infection in over 10 years, and I can't
>remember if I had this reaction before. Any suggestions??
>
>--
>stacey
>

Stacey

This is often the effect you get thefirst day of using yeast meds for a yeast infection. i would continue it and see if it improves.
